Trying to factor as a Difference of Cubes:

 1.1      Factoring:  x3y3-r3 

Theory : A difference of two perfect cubes,  a3 - b3 can be factored into
              (a-b) • (a2 +ab +b2)

Proof :  (a-b)•(a2+ab+b2) =
            a3+a2b+ab2-ba2-b2a-b3 =
            a3+(a2b-ba2)+(ab2-b2a)-b3 =
            a3+0+0-b3 =
            a3-b3


Check :  x3 is the cube of   x1

Check :  y3 is the cube of   y1

Check :  r3 is the cube of   r1

Factorization is :
             (xy - r)  •  (x2y2 + xyr + r2)

Theory - Roots of a product :

 2.1    A product of several terms equals zero. 

 
When a product of two or more terms equals zero, then at least one of the terms must be zero. 

 
We shall now solve each term = 0 separately 

 
In other words, we are going to solve as many equations as there are terms in the product 

 
Any solution of term = 0 solves product = 0 as well.
